How they compare

U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as) currently reports 3.9% against 3.2% in Senegal, a difference of 0.7%.

That makes U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)'s figure about 1.2 times Senegal's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2008 it was U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as) ahead.

Senegal ranks 27th and U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as) ranks 24th of 83 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Senegal averaged higher in 1 and U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as) in 2.
